From 00fda34dd9bbe207583d7fac19b306ae32db18f0 Mon Sep 17 00:00:00 2001
From: schangxiang@126.com <schangxiang@126.com>
Date: 周一, 31 3月 2025 11:00:32 +0800
Subject: [PATCH] 22

---
 LA24030_LuLiPackageLine_Pda/pages/untie/untie.vue |   62 ++++++++++++++++++++++++++----
 1 files changed, 53 insertions(+), 9 deletions(-)

diff --git a/LA24030_LuLiPackageLine_Pda/pages/untie/untie.vue b/LA24030_LuLiPackageLine_Pda/pages/untie/untie.vue
index 2f92f0e..25852e7 100644
--- a/LA24030_LuLiPackageLine_Pda/pages/untie/untie.vue
+++ b/LA24030_LuLiPackageLine_Pda/pages/untie/untie.vue
@@ -94,6 +94,13 @@
                   </text>
                 </u-col>
               </u-row>
+			  <u-row>
+			    <u-col span="12">
+			      <text class="color_80 padding_left25rpx">
+			        <text class="color_80"> 娆″簭锛歿{ item.shelf }} </text>
+			      </text>
+			    </u-col>
+			  </u-row>
               <u-row>
                 <u-col span="12">
                   <text class="color_80 padding_left25rpx">
@@ -130,13 +137,13 @@
                   </text>
                 </u-col>
               </u-row>
-              <u-row>
-                <u-col span="12">
-                  <text class="color_80 padding_left25rpx">
-                    <text class="color_80"> 娆″簭锛歿{ item.shelf }} </text>
-                  </text>
-                </u-col>
-              </u-row>
+			   <u-row>
+			  			    <u-col span="12">
+			  			      <text class="color_80 padding_left25rpx">
+			  			        鏍囪锛歿{ getUpiFlagEnumName(item.upiFlag) }}
+			  			      </text>
+			  			    </u-col>
+			  			  </u-row>
               <u-row>
                 <u-col span="12">
                   <text class="color_80 padding_left25rpx">
@@ -291,8 +298,9 @@
     <button-modal
       :subShow="true"
       garmenTitle="閲嶇疆"
+	  subTitle="纭NG"
       @submit="rest"
-      @reset="rest"
+      @reset="do_UnlineForNGPackage"
     />
   </view>
 </template>
@@ -307,6 +315,7 @@
   onlyUpdateDutyCycle,
   getBhbMaterialList,
   getenumDataList,
+  UnlineForNGPackage
 } from "../../api/putIn/artificial.js";
 export default {
   data() {
@@ -346,6 +355,7 @@
       kwbhAllowed: false,
       enumList: [],
       areaCodeEnum: [],
+	  upiFlagEnum: [],
     };
   },
   components: {
@@ -364,7 +374,11 @@
     }).then((res) => {
       this.areaCodeEnum = res.result || [];
     });
-
+   getenumDataList({
+   	  EnumName: "UpiFlagEnum",
+   	}).then((res) => {
+   	  this.upiFlagEnum = res.result || [];
+   	});
   },
   onLoad() {
     this.operator = JSON.parse(uni.getStorageSync("userInfo")).name;
@@ -372,6 +386,31 @@
   mounted() {},
 
   methods: {
+	  do_UnlineForNGPackage() {
+		   //debugger
+	      const params = {
+			  PackageCode:this.singlist[0].packageCode,
+			  IsNG:true
+	      };
+		  //debugger
+	      uni.showModal({
+	        title: "鏁村寘NG涓嬬嚎",
+	        content: "鏄惁纭 鏁村寘NG涓嬬嚎锛�",
+	        showCancel: true,
+	        cancelColor: "#333333",
+	        success: (res) => {
+	          if (res.confirm) {
+	            UnlineForNGPackage(params).then((res) => {
+	              this.rescode = 200;
+	              this.$refs.resmodal.show = true;
+	              this.resmessage = "鏁村寘NG涓嬬嚎鎴愬姛";
+	            });
+	          } else if (res.cancel) {
+	          }
+	        },
+	      });
+	  
+	    },
     getEnumName(value) {
       const name = this.enumList.find((item) => item.value === value);
       return name ? name.name : "";
@@ -380,6 +419,10 @@
       const name = this.areaCodeEnum.find((item) => item.value === value);
       return name ? name.name : "";
     },
+	 getUpiFlagEnumName(value) {
+		  const name = this.upiFlagEnum.find((item) => item.value === value);
+		  return name ? name.name : "";
+		},
     // 濡傛灉鎵撳紑涓�涓殑鏃跺�欙紝涓嶉渶瑕佸叧闂叾浠栵紝鍒欐棤闇�瀹炵幇鏈柟娉�
     open(index) {
       // 鍏堝皢姝e湪琚搷浣滅殑swipeAction鏍囪涓烘墦寮�鐘舵�侊紝鍚﹀垯鐢变簬props鐨勭壒鎬ч檺鍒讹紝
@@ -399,6 +442,7 @@
     },
 
     rest() {
+		//alert(11)
       this.warehouse.upi = "";
       this.warehouse.upi = "";
       this.singlist = [];

--
Gitblit v1.9.3